STAGE SET FOR LAUNCH OF SIAYA PROJECTS

The stage is set for next month’s ground breaking ceremony for the modernization of Siaya Referral Hospital and expansion of Jaramogi Oginga Odinga Stadium.

Defence Cabinet Secretary Hon Soipan Tuya on Tuesday hosted Siaya Governor H.E James Orengo at Ulinzi House to review the progress of preliminary activities for the two priority Government infrastructure projects.

The review exercise, also attended by Defence Principal Secretary Dr Patrick Mariru and Director Personnel and Logistics Major General Edward Rugendo, included harmonization of architectural drawings and scope of works.

In partnership with Siaya County Government, the Ministry of Defence (MOD) through Kenya Defence Forces (KDF) will oversee the construction of a new 5-storey block that will expand the capacity of Siaya Level 5 Hospital by 500 beds.

The expansion of Jaramogi Oginga Odinga Stadium that will include construction of new terraces and roof will raise the multi-sport facility’s capacity from the current 5,500 to 20,000-seater.

MOD’s Chief of Special Projects Brig Titus Sokobe and Head of Supply Chain Management Mr Willis Olwalo were present in the meeting also attended by Siaya County Executive Committee Members (CECMs) Mr George Nyingiro (Finance and Planning) and Maurice McOrege (Lands and Physical Planning).
